π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

8 items
  • 2 pieces green tea bags
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ice
  • 4 cups water
  • 1 cup ice cubes
  • 5 leaves mint leaves (optional for garnish)
  • 2 slices lemon slices (optional for garnish)

πŸ“ Instructions

7 steps
1

In a small saucepan, bring 4 cups of water to a gentle boil over medium heat.

2

Peel and grate 1 tablespoon of fresh ginger. Add the ginger to the boiling water and let it simmer for 2 minutes to release its flavor.

3

Remove the saucepan from the heat and add 2 green tea bags. Cover and let steep for 3 minutes.

4

Remove the tea bags and strain the ginger pieces out of the tea using a fine sieve or strainer.

5

Stir in 2 tablespoons of honey and 2 tablespoons of lemon juice until fully dissolved. Let the mixture cool to room temperature.

6

Fill 2 glasses with a total of 1 cup of ice cubes. Pour the cooled green tea ginger mixture over the ice, dividing it evenly between the glasses.

7

Garnish with mint leaves and lemon slices if desired. Serve immediately and enjoy your Green Tea Ginger Cooler!
